Health Law Schools in Washington
In 2022-2023, 4 students earned their Health Law degrees in WA.
In terms of popularity, Health Law is the 286th most popular major in the state out of a total 463 majors commonly available.

Jobs for Health Law Grads in Washington
There are 11,000 people in the state and 642,750 people in the nation working in health law jobs.
Wages for Health Law Jobs in Washington
In this state, health law grads earn an average of $136,480. Nationwide, they make an average of $144,230.
